bourdainbeirutwh.jpg I’m a little slow on reporting this, but have to admit to often hit and missing on Anthony Bourdain’s show on the Travel Channel these days, so no big surprise I just now decided to post about his show’s trip, to of all places, Beruit. Talk about bad timing.

From World Hum: The Travel Channel aired Anthony Bourdain in Beirut last night, the story of what happened to the “No Reservations” host and his crew when they were stranded in Beirut, Lebanon last month during the early days of the war between Israel and Hezbollah. “It’s not a hard-news account of what happened to Lebanon or what happened to Beirut,” Bourdain says at the beginning of the show. “I think at best it’s a little bit of what Beirut was and could have been. What it felt like to be there when things went sideways. This is not the show we went to Lebanon to get.” Nevertheless, Bourdain returned with one of the more compelling travel shows—or any television show, for that matter—of the year.
